9
Movies
5.5
Rating
Avg Rating
After the Cat
2024
Mon Mon Mon Monsters
2017
Eel
2025
Workers The Movie
2023
Ahma & Alan
2020
Synapses
2019
Gender
Female
Also Known As
Ohong Village
Home
2013
Cocoon